TI All that coughs is not (respiratory) allergy
QU Journal of Asthma 1993; 30(4): 319-21
PT journal article
AB A 54-year-old nun was referred to a respiratory specialist for cough, which was subsequently found to be the prodrome of Creutzfeldt-Jakob disease. It is tempting for any specialist to assume whoever enters his office has the disease of his specialty. Potential pitfalls in that sort of diagnostic judgment are displayed in this report.
